The Future of Democracy in Africa: Voices from Africa’s Leading Think Tanks

 

Synopsis

This book establishes a bold premise: African democracy is not only in crisis—it is conceptually broken. To salvage its future, Africans must reject tokenistic definitions of democracy (like mere elections) and reimagine it as a holistic, interconnected system of institutions and freedoms.

Through this volume, public policy thinkers and reform-minded leaders offer concrete, region-specific ideas to revitalize African democracy for the next generation—not by imitating the West, but by building on Africa’s own evolving democratic ambitions.

Applied Economics for Africa

 

Synopsis

In this book, George Ayittey argues that Africa’s underdevelopment stems not from a lack of resources, but from oppressive governance and imported economic ideologies that overlook indigenous practices. He advocates for a return to Africa’s traditional economic systems—rooted in free village markets, consensus-based democracy, and private property—as the foundation for modern prosperity.
